Mumbai: Maharashtra State Chief Minister Eknath Shinde assured in the State Legislative Assembly on Monday that the state delegation will meet Prime Minister Narendra Modi and request him regarding giving the status of classical language to Marathi language.


NCP Member Chhagan Bhujbal raised the issue of giving the status of classical language to Marathi on the occasion of Marathi Raj Bhasha Gaurav Day.


While making a statement, Mr. Shinde said that keeping in mind the sentiments of all the members of the House, the Chief Minister, Deputy Chief Minister and the delegation of the state will soon meet the Prime Minister and request them to take action on granting the status of classical language to Marathi at the earliest, added Mr Shinde.
